Uploaded image for project: 'Magnolia'
  1. Magnolia
  2. MAGNOLIA-5529

Update mechanism improvements

    XMLWordPrintable

    Details

    • Type: Story
    • Status: Open
    • Priority: Neutral
    • Resolution: Unresolved
    • Affects Version/s: None
    • Fix Version/s: None
    • Labels:
      None

      Attachments

      1.
      Update tasks : streamline class names, functionality and provide a couple more useful abstractions Sub-task Closed Unassigned
      2.
      Accessing the update pages should require some sort of user login Sub-task Closed Unassigned
      3.
      Warn user when installing snapshot versions Sub-task Closed Unassigned
      4.
      The title of the status page should be different when the update is complete and it is ready to start. Sub-task Closed Unassigned
      5.
      Updatemech : review exception handling (loading and lifecycle) Sub-task Closed Unassigned
      6.
      updatemech : core could maybe register the default workspaces Sub-task Closed Unassigned
      7.
      updatemech : certains tasks can be optional Sub-task Closed Unassigned
      8.
      update: forms in UI for entering configuration Sub-task Closed Unassigned
      9.
      Updatemech : observation should be "paused" Sub-task Closed Unassigned
      10.
      Module startup failure should still start observation of that module, or stop it. Sub-task Closed Unassigned
      11.
      Remove repository/workspace mappings from module descriptors Sub-task Closed Unassigned
      12.
      Add support for repository-only modules Sub-task Closed Unassigned
      13.
      Module dependency issue should be displayed in update ui Sub-task Closed Unassigned
      14.
      Update mechanism : better feedback to user Sub-task Closed Unassigned
      15.
      Bootstrap tasks should support backup Sub-task Closed Unassigned
      16.
      Review bootstrap install tasks Sub-task Closed Unassigned
      17.
      Write tests for various bootstrap procedures Sub-task Closed Unassigned
      18.
      Refactoring / cleanup of the bootstrap classes methods Sub-task Closed Magnolia International
      19.
      installation/update: execute tasks after a later installation of an optional module Sub-task Closed Unassigned
      20.
      update: support phases (before, after repository is started) Sub-task Closed Magnolia International
      21.
      Further wording improvements on install/update screens Sub-task Closed Unassigned
      22.
      ModuleLifecycle : allow usage of the Task api and global save/rollback Sub-task Closed Magnolia International
      23.
      Delta tasks should fail gracefully Sub-task Open Unassigned

        Activity

          People

          Assignee:
          Unassigned Unassigned
          Reporter:
          gjoseph Magnolia International
          Votes:
          0 Vote for this issue
          Watchers:
          1 Start watching this issue

            Dates

            Created:
            Updated: